From 95161be82290dfff17fe9cea9eba8043c2ff675e Mon Sep 17 00:00:00 2001 From: Your Name Date: Fri, 6 Sep 2024 12:57:38 -0600 Subject: [PATCH] Usuario --- action/action_puestos_excel.php |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/action/action_puestos_excel.php b/action/action_puestos_excel.php index 45d18c5..b1daf82 100644 --- a/action/action_puestos_excel.php +++ b/action/action_puestos_excel.php @@ -3,8 +3,11 @@ $ruta = "../"; require_once "../vendor/autoload.php"; require_once "../class/c_login.php"; -$user = Login::get_user(); -$user->print_to_log('Genera excel de materias por puesto'); +if (!isset($_SESSION['user'])) { + http_response_code(401); + die(json_encode(['error' => 'unauthorized'])); +} +$user = unserialize($_SESSION['user']); use PhpOffice\PhpSpreadsheet\Spreadsheet; use PhpOffice\PhpSpreadsheet\IOFactory;